What is TextPipe?

TextPipe is a powerful text transformation, conversion, cleansing, and extraction workbench that consolidates multiple text processing functions into a single tool. With TextPipe, users can manage all their text processing tasks in one place, eliminating the need to juggle various text editors, command line tools, custom scripts, and office macros. The application offers extensive capabilities, enabling users to efficiently convert, transform, and repurpose data from a wide range of text file formats, including HTML, XML, and other structured documents from the web, fixed-length or delimited files (CSV, Tab, Pipe, etc.), Unix, Mainframe, and PC/Windows end-of-line formats, files within Zip archives, and the latest Microsoft Office 2007 formats (DOCX, XLSX, PPTX). TextPipe also supports ASCII, ANSI, Unicode, and EBCDIC files, as well as security log files from firewalls, web servers, and structured formats like EDIFACT, HL7, and SWIFT. The tool can handle structured and unstructured reports of any size or dimension, including spooled print files
